Clinical Application
This olive-shaped tip is intended to provide a smooth, atraumatic leading surface for Nabatoff-style cannulae and suction instruments. The rounded profile reduces point pressure on soft tissues during probing, blunt dilation, placement or atraumatic manipulation of narrow lumens and cavities. It is useful wherever a blunt, non-cutting tip is preferred to minimize mucosal or soft-tissue trauma while maintaining lumen patency for suction or fluid exchange.
Design & Configuration
The olive geometry provides a continuous, rounded leading edge that disperses contact force and minimizes focal trauma during insertion or manipulation. A tapered transition from the shank to the olive head facilitates atraumatic passage through portals and aids controlled dilation when required. The detachable configuration allows the tip to be fitted to a compatible Nabatoff 6 mm cannula, enabling quick exchange, cleaning and reprocessing between cases.

Material & Construction
Manufactured from surgical-grade stainless steel to provide corrosion resistance, durability and repeatable performance under standard sterilization cycles. The single-piece olive head and attachment shank are finished to a smooth profile to minimize tissue adhesion and to facilitate cleaning. Constructed for reusable clinical use.
